REQUIRED :
- Bachelors / Masters degree in Electronics & Electrical engineering with 10+ years of experience in protocols like NAND(FLASH) Toggle mode / Onfi, DDR3 / 4 / 5, LPDDR3 / 4 / 5 GDDR3 / 4 / 5 / 6, HBM2 / 3 / 3E and other High speed interfaces.
- Thorough understanding of High-Speed PHY and Datapath architectures and other clock recovery schemes.
- Conversant with tools such as Cadence Virtuoso / Synopsys custom compiler / Hspice / Spectre / Finesim including statistical simulation methodologies.
- Experience in Mixed-mode simulation and analog / digital co-simulation will be of added advantage.
- Experience in creating EDA models such as Verilog model, Liberty etc will be of added advantage.
